NJPW G1 Climax 27: Day 4
0.00% | July 22, 2017 |
The fourth night of G1 Climax 27 took place at Korakuen Hall in Tokyo, Japan on July 22, 2017.
Featured Crew
0
Cast
Aaron Frobel
Michael Elgin
Kazuchika Okada
Kazuchika Okada
Tyson Smith
Kenny Omega
Alipate Aloisio Leone
Tama Tonga
Minoru Suzuki
Minoru Suzuki